Chancellor Plowman Announces 2023-24 Leadership Academy Class 

August 14, 2023

Chancellor Donde Plowman has announced the second class of the Chancellor’s Leadership Academy, which includes 30 deans, associate deans, directors, department heads, and other faculty and staff from across the university.   The eight-month program launched in 2022 to identify emerging campus leaders and further develop their professional and personal leadership skills.
